Before Motown, Detroit had "Black Bottom" -- a neighborhood that
grew out of segregation and thrived in music, culture and the arts, but
was cut short by urban development. Violinist Regina Carter grew up in
that musically rich city and discusses several areas and aspects of Detroit that
are gone but not forgotten.
